Rightly named after the ultimate ceremonial honour in the British tradition, Royal Salute 62-Gun Salute resonates with time-honoured traditions. The firing of 62 cannons, an exclusive privilege of the Tower of London, is reserved only for the most special Royal anniversaries. The sculpted crystal piece designed to house such liquid of undisputed provenance and quality, was created by Master Craftsmen at Dartington Crystal. Each decanter is individually blown by the Master Glass Blowers who, pushing the very limits of their skill, mould the elegant shape of the crystal clear inner wall, and delicately coat it with a midnight blue crystal outer wall. The bottle is then hand cut with a diamond-tipped tool so that both the clear glass and tantalizing glimpses of the golden whisky might be revealed through the blue crystal. For the final touch, the crest is then engraved and anointed with liquid gold, all of it by hand. Each decanter is the result of over forty hours of care and attention.
